How much do finance manager evening j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average yearly pay for finance manager evening in the United States is $124,326.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$94,500.00 and $168,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

The Finance and Insurance Manager is responsible for producing additional income for the dealership by selling finance and insurance programs to new and used vehicle customers.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Establish and maintain good working relationships with several finance sources, factory and otherwise.
  • Submit paperwork to and obtain approval from finance sources on all finance deals.
  • Work with Sales Managers to ensure a reasonable profit from every sale.
  • Handle all rate quotations. Establish and meet monthly objectives.
  • Instruct salespeople in the methods of selling finance.

Qualifications:

  • Experienced Automotive Business/F&I Manager, or 2+ years in a successful automotive sales position
  • Strong attention to detail and 100% compliance with legal and regulatory rules
  • Knowledge of dealership finance and insurance procedures.
  • Strong oral, written, and presentation skills
  • Desire to achieve and succeed Ability to multitask in a fast paced environment
  • Willingness to work with a team Proven track record in a previous Sales and/or Sales or F&I Management role
  • Will work at desk in an office setting. Computer knowledge is necessary. May be required to leave the dealership occasionally to contact finance sources.

Evening, holiday and weekend work hours will be required
